Summary

Ray is an open-source project that allows users to parallelize Python processes and integrates with whylogs, a monitoring solution for machine learning models in production. Ray makes it easy to divide large datasets into smaller chunks and process them in parallel, generating whylogs profiles along the way. This enables users to monitor their ML models' performance and behavior in real-time. By using Ray pipelines and whylogs, users can easily integrate these tools into their workflows for data analysis and model monitoring.
